By Jane Bussmann. Photographs by Wayne Maser



It's Mischa's moment
Her role in The O.C. may be history, but things are on the up for Mischa Barton. Currently making a film with Richard Attenborough and set to study at RADA this summer, she talks fashion, fame and the Hollywood It-crowd

Mischa Barton looks pretty good for someone who just died in a car crash. American teenagers tuning into the season finale of youth soap phenomenon The O.C. were distraught to see one of their most popular characters – Mischa's alter ego, the beautiful, privileged, Californian calamity case Marissa Cooper – expiring in the arms of her ex-boyfriend. Untimely soap deaths range from the sublime (Emmerdale's Batley the dog) to the ridiculous (Dynasty's Moldavian massacre). 'So I have to say, I feel very lucky!' winces Mischa. The big death scene could have been camp, but Mischa is a young player who takes her game seriously. 'I had to die right on camera, so I wanted it to be up to standard for the fans,' she explains. 'I didn't want people laughing.'

The 20-year-old, 5ft 9in New Yorker is in Canada shooting a new movie, but right now the two of us are stalking the streets of Toronto looking for a vegan restaurant. Students eating chips spin to see if it's really her, checking out her long bare legs and preppy top. A paparazzo lurks behind Mischa, as usual; the Barton cheekbones are worth a tabloid fortune. Her skin could be that of a child and her eyes are vast and blue. Even up close, Mischa Barton looks like a cartoon kitten.

'Wish I'd brought a camera, look at this city – such a good atmosphere,' she sighs. 'I had to be in bed early, but one street seemed to have about ten clubs.' Mischa Barton is a free spirit with a strong work ethic. 'I get up at 4.30 to get to the set. Sleeping in is my favourite thing on the planet.' You'd certainly need a kip after three years playing Marissa, what with an eating disorder, lesbian affairs and your mum shagging your ex. Oh, and shooting your ex-boyfriend's jailbird brother after he attempted to r*pe you. Confused? Marissa occasionally was. 'We sometimes shot two episodes at once, 12- or 14-hour days,' she says. The effort paid off with global stardom: Mischa appears in 33,500 different photos on one fansite alone.

'Beverly Hills [90210] and Melrose Place were so huge in their day, but looked a little dated; people were ready for something edgier, grittier,' she says. And grittier it was. One of the most interesting episodes was when Marissa overdosed in Mexico – 'a bottle of tequila, maybe Vicodin,' she says. Marissa's lesbian kiss, however, was 'something of an anticlimax', although Mischa did giggle with co-star Olivia Wilde. 'But Olivia always makes me giggle, she's so funny.' Mischa is still friends with The O.C. crew: 'Leaving is like leaving school – you miss them.'

She's excited about moving on, though. 'For the first time, I have freedom,' she says, but she's also grateful for the security that comes with a hit show, which has allowed her to buy her new Los Angeles home, for instance. 'It's comfortable, Mediterranean style, nothing glam, but I love my pool and my dogs play in my backyard.'
